How much is a pound of mashed potatoes?

The United States Department of Agriculture considers that a serving of mashed potatoes is 1 cup, which equals 210 grams (g) or almost half a pound (0.46 pounds). But don’t let anyone dictate(r) to you the size of a mashed potato serving. If you want to eat 2 cups, or even 3, it’s your decision.

How much does mashed potatoes cost?

Homemade mashed potatoes At $3.99 for a five pound bag of Yukon Gold potatoes and 65 cents in butter and milk, homemade wins in the cost department. The standard serving size for mashed potatoes used by caterers is about 2/3 cup mashed potatoes per person.

How much does a pound of potatoes cost?

Depending on the type of potato, the costs will vary anywhere from $1 to $2 per pound on average . Larger quantities can cost as little as $2 to $5 per 10-pound bag. How much does a bag of russet potatoes cost?

Refer to our table below to see what popular varieties will cost. For instance, a 5-pound bag of russet potatoes could retail for $3 to $5. A 5-pound bag of white potatoes can cost $2 to $4 each. Fingerlings average $1.50 to $2.50 per pound.

How much does a pound of fingerling potatoes cost?

Fingerlings average $1.50 to $2.50 per pound. A gold potato will cost $1 to $2.50 per pound. Purple potatoes can average $1 to $2 per pound and red potatoes can cost $1.25 to $2.50 per pound.

What makes mashed potatoes “mealy”?

The classic russet potato , with its slightly wrinkly brown skin and multi-purpose texture is a good one for mashed potatoes. You might describe the texture as mealy, as opposed to firm. This is because they have a low moisture content and high starches.

What is the best mashed potato recipe?

Bring a pot of salted water to a boil. Add potatoes; cook until tender but still firm. Drain and return to stove over low heat to dry for 1 to 2 minutes. Add butter, Parmesan cheese, chives, cream cheese, garlic, salt, and pepper. Use a potato masher to mash until smooth, and serve.
